A peculiar phrase originating from Dutch internet culture has gone viral worldwide, sparking discussions on social media and linguistic circles. The phrase “Bro hoe is het” has been viewed and shared extensively, often used in contexts unrelated to its traditional meaning.
For uninitiated individuals unfamiliar with Dutch online jargon, the phrase translates to “Bro, how are you?” The casual and informal nature of the greeting, typical of contemporary language used by many Dutch-speaking internet users, seems to have transcended borders and age groups.
The rise of the meme is largely attributed to its adaptability and relatability. People from various cultures and age groups have redefined the phrase to convey excitement, frustration, or even sarcastic responses to trivial or mundane questions.
